Introduction

Before diving into the world of passive income, let’s clarify what it means and why it’s gaining popularity among individuals from all walks of life. Passive income refers to money earned regularly with minimal effort or active involvement. Unlike traditional earned income where you exchange time for money, passive income allows you to make money even when you’re not directly working on it.

What is Passive Income?

Passive income can come from various sources, including investments, businesses, or intellectual property. It is a way to build multiple streams of income that provide financial stability and long-term wealth. While passive income may require initial effort and time to set up, once established, it can continue to generate revenue with little to no additional work.

  1. Rental Property Investment: Your Cash Cow
  2. Investing in real estate can be a lucrative way to earn passive income. Owning a rental property allows you to generate consistent rental income while building equity in the property over time.

    Investing in a rental property requires careful research and planning. You should consider factors like location, property type, and potential rental income before making a purchase. Additionally, you can hire a property management company to handle day-to-day operations, making it a more hands-off investment.

  3. High-Yield Dividend Stocks: Money While You Sleep
  4. Investing in dividend stocks can provide a steady stream of passive income through regular dividend payments.

    Dividend-paying companies share a portion of their profits with shareholders, making it an attractive option for long-term investors. By reinvesting dividends, you can accelerate your earnings through compounding. Remember to research and diversify your dividend stock portfolio to minimize risks.

  15. Investing in Real Estate Investment Trusts (REITs): Diversify Your Earnings
  16. REITs are companies that own or finance income-producing real estate, allowing investors to benefit from the rental income generated.

    Investing in REITs provides an opportunity to diversify your real estate portfolio without the hassles of property management. Research different types of REITs and choose those that align with your investment goals.

  27. Dropshipping: Minimal Investment, Maximum Returns
  28. Dropshipping allows you to sell products online without the need for inventory.

    Partner with suppliers who handle product storage and shipping. When a customer places an order, the supplier fulfills it, and you earn a profit from the price difference.

Passive income is not

Passive income is not a get-rich-quick scheme. It requires initial effort, time, and dedication to set up and establish reliable income streams. While passive income can provide financial freedom and flexibility, it is not entirely hands-off, and monitoring and occasional maintenance may be necessary to ensure continued success. Additionally, passive income is not a guaranteed source of income, and some ventures may not yield the expected returns.

Remember to conduct your due diligence and tailor passive income ideas to suit your financial goals and circumstances.

Cons of Passive Income Ideas

Time and Effort to Set Up: While passive income may be “passive” once established, it requires time, effort, and sometimes capital to set up the income streams initially.

Market Risk: Some passive income ideas, like investing in the stock market or real estate, are subject to market fluctuations and economic conditions, which can affect returns.

Lack of Control: In certain passive income ventures, such as affiliate marketing or dropshipping, you may have limited control over product quality, shipping, or customer service, which can impact your reputation.

Competition: Popular passive income ideas often have significant competition, making it essential to find a unique selling proposition or niche to stand out.

Potential for Losses: Not all passive income ideas guarantee profit. Some ventures may not perform as expected, leading to potential losses.

Learning Curve: Some passive income ideas, like creating online courses or developing mobile apps, may require acquiring new skills or knowledge, which can involve a learning curve.
